导航
当前位置:首页>>app
在线生成app,封装app

net core开发安卓应用

2023-10-31 围观 : 13次

为什么.NET Core能够用于安卓应用开发?

首先,.NET Core是一个跨平台的开发框架,由Microsoft推出,其目的是为了让开发人员能够在不同的操作系统之间进行代码共享。.NET Core是一个轻量级框架,因此它可以在多个操作系统上使用,包括Windows、Linux和macOS等。由于.NET Core开发的应用程序可以在各种操作系统上运行,因此.NET Core可以成为多种应用程序开发的理想选择。而且最近的新版本已经支持开发安卓应用。

如何使用.NET Core开发安卓应用?

要使用.NET Core开发安卓应用,首先需要安装Visual Studio。然后,将开发环境设置为安卓开发环境,以便能够创建基于安卓的应用程序。接下来,必须安装以下工具:

- .NET Core SDK: 这是用于安装.NET Core的命令行工具,可以跨平台使用。

- Android SDK: 这是一个包含用于安卓应用开发的工具的软件套件,包括开发者工具和平台工具。

- Android NDK: 这是安卓应用程序开发的一个工具包,主要用于开发JNI应用程序。

然后,使用Visual Studio创建一个新的.NET Core项目,并将应用程序类型设置为安卓应用程序,即可开始编写代码。使用Visual Studio中提供的安卓模拟器,可以在本地环境中运行、测试应用程序。

当需要将应用程序部署到真实的安卓设备上时,必须在设备中启用开发者选项,并通过USB连接将设备连接到开发工作站。运行“adb devices”命令,以确认设备连接正常。最后,使用adb命令将应用程序安装到设备上。

总结:

.NET Core最初是在Windows和Linux环境中使用,但最近Microsoft已经开发出了.NET Core在安卓应用程序中的支持,可以很容易地使用现有的.NET Core知识开发安卓应用程序。由于.NET Core是一个跨平台框架,因此您可以将应用程序开发为其他操作系统上的应用程序,或者将Android应用程序移植到其他操作系统上。这使得.NET Core成为一种非常有用的开发框架,可以支持多种应用程序开发需求。

相关文章
  • h5打包apk体验

    随着移动互联网的发展,越来越多的网页应用被转化为移动应用,以满足用户的需求。H5技术作为移动应用开发的一种新兴技术,也被越来越多的开发者所使用。但是,H5应用还需要通过打包成APK文件才能在安卓设备上运行。本文将介绍H5打包APK的原理和详细步骤。一、H5打包APK的原理H5打包APK的原理是将H5...

    2023-10-13
  • 制作空间软件

    制作空间软件需要考虑到很多因素,包括空间环境、通信技术、计算机科学等方面。在这里,我们将介绍制作空间软件的原理和详细步骤。一、原理制作空间软件的原理主要包括以下几个方面:1. 空间环境:空间环境的特殊性质需要考虑到宇宙辐射、温度变化、气压变化等因素,这些因素对软件的设计和开发产生了很大的影响。2. ...

    2023-11-16
  • 手机h5制作软件app有哪些

    随着手机的普及,移动端网页已经成为了人们获取信息、分享体验、娱乐消遣等主要途径之一。手机H5页是移动端网页的一种表现形式,具有互动性强、视觉效果好、易于分享等优点,能够满足用户对于移动端网页的各种需求。但是,H5页面制作需要一定的技术基础,对于非专业人员来说有一定的门槛。为了满足广大非专业人员制作H...

    2023-11-25
  • apple 开发者客服

    Apple开发者客服是苹果公司为苹果开发者提供的一项优质服务。其主要目的是通过提供专业的技术支持和与开发者的交流,以确保苹果开发者所开发的应用程序能够在苹果的软件和硬件平台上正常运行。Apple开发者客服可以与苹果开发者沟通,帮助他们解决开发中可能遇到的问题,并提供了与苹果公司产品和服务相关的支持。...

    2023-11-09
  • app 开发 消息推送

    随着移动互联网的日益发展,手机应用程序(App)的重要性在不断提升。如今的手机App不单是简单的功能工具,更是为了与用户保持长期互动和提高用户体验不可或缺的推送消息平台。本文将从原理和应用两个方面介绍移动应用推送通知(Push Notification)的工作方式。一、 简介移动应用程序推送通知是一...

    2023-11-06